Rain detection systems automatically activate wipers by sensing moisture on windshields, improving visibility and driver convenience during wet conditions.

 

 

The development of Rain Detection Systems has significantly improved driving safety and convenience, particularly in challenging weather conditions. These systems use advanced sensors to detect the presence of rain on a vehicle’s windshield and automatically activate the wipers, ensuring clear visibility without requiring driver intervention.

Rain detection systems typically rely on optical sensors that measure the amount of water on the windshield. When rain droplets are detected, the system sends a signal to activate the wipers at an appropriate speed. This automatic response helps maintain optimal visibility, allowing drivers to focus on the road.

One of the key benefits of rain detection systems is their ability to adjust wiper speed based on the intensity of rainfall. During light rain, the system operates the wipers at a slower speed, while heavy rain triggers faster operation. This adaptability enhances driving comfort and reduces the need for manual adjustments.

The integration of rain detection systems with other vehicle technologies is further enhancing their functionality. For example, these systems can work in conjunction with automatic headlights to improve visibility during low-light and rainy conditions. This level of integration contributes to a more seamless and intuitive driving experience.

Rain detection systems are also becoming an essential component of advanced driver assistance systems. By ensuring clear visibility, they support the effective operation of other safety features such as lane-keeping assistance and collision avoidance systems. This makes them a valuable addition to modern vehicles.
